Crude oil remains a foundational resource impacting global energy prices, primarily where heating fuels like heating oil, propane, or natural gas are derived or priced in relation to petroleum markets. When crude oil prices spike due to geopolitical tensions, supply chain disruptions, or increased demand, the ripple effect often leads to higher fuel costs for home heating.

This impact can be significant for homes dependent on oil-fired boilers or furnaces. According to the U.S. Energy Information Administration, a 10% increase in crude oil prices can translate to a nearly 8% rise in heating oil prices, directly pushing up monthly heating bills. In contrast, electricity or natural gas prices may respond differently based on regional energy mixes and infrastructure.

Global Economic Conditions and Inflationary Pressures

Beyond fuel prices, broader economic trends including inflation, currency fluctuations, and trade policies influence heating system manufacturing, transportation, and installation costs. For example, inflation increases the cost of raw materials such as steel, copper, and plastics used in heating components, affecting system prices.

Supply chain bottlenecks, as seen during recent global disruptions, have exacerbated lead times and costs for HVAC equipment. These factors combined explain why during periods of economic uncertainty, buying or upgrading your home heating system can become more expensive.

Market Demand and Technological Innovation

High global demand for energy-efficient heating technologies also affects system costs through economies of scale and investment cycles. As more households pursue heat pumps and smart heating controls to reduce emissions and energy bills, manufacturers ramp production, which can eventually lower prices.

Conversely, rapid innovation cycles may cause earlier models to depreciate quickly, affecting resale values and perceived long-term affordability.

2. Crude Oil Impact: Case Study on Heating Fuel Variability

Historical Price Volatility

Examining the last two decades, crude oil prices have experienced significant volatility, from lows near $30/barrel to highs above $120/barrel. These swings have directly influenced heating fuel markets—for instance, the 2008 oil price peak caused a heating fuel crisis in colder regions of the US and Europe.

Homeowners faced suddenly steep heating bills that underscored dependence on volatile fossil fuels. This propelled interest in alternative heating systems including electric heat pumps, which have more stable costs linked to electricity rather than crude oil prices.

Regional Dependency and Price Sensitivity

The impact of crude oil price fluctuations differs dramatically by region. Areas dependent on heating oil, often in the northeastern US or parts of Canada, see a near-immediate effect on home heating costs. In contrast, regions supplied predominantly by natural gas or electricity experience more buffered price changes due to diverse fuel sources.

Understanding your local market and fuel source is critical for anticipating how global crude oil trends might affect your home energy bills and which heating system makes the most economic sense.

Proactive Measures to Mitigate Crude Oil Instability

To manage risk, homeowners can consider strategies like fuel contracts locking in prices, investing in hybrid heating systems, or switching to modern heat pumps with renewable energy sources.

These options increase resilience to global price shocks and stability in heating expenses.

6. Comparing Heating System Technologies and Market Sensitivities

Heating System Primary Fuel/Power Sensitivity to Crude Oil Upfront Cost Operational Cost Volatility Typical Lifespan
Oil Boiler/Furnace Heating oil (crude oil derivative) High – directly tied to oil prices Moderate – depends on market High – fuel cost varies with crude oil 15–20 years
Natural Gas Furnace Natural gas Moderate – indirect effect via fuel substitution markets Moderate Medium 15–20 years
Electric Heat Pump Electricity (mix depends on grid) Low – electricity less tied to crude oil Higher upfront Lower 15–25 years
Electric Resistance Heater Electricity Low Low Higher if grid is fossil-based 10–15 years
Propane Furnace Propane (oil derivative) High Moderate High 15–20 years
Pro Tip: Selecting a heating system with diversified fuel sources reduces vulnerability to global oil price shocks and stabilizes long-term costs.

Embracing Hybrid Heating Solutions

Hybrid systems combining heat pumps with backup fossil fuel heaters offer operational flexibility amid fluctuating energy prices.

Homeowners can switch modes based on seasonal prices, helping stabilize costs without sacrificing comfort.

FAQ: Your Questions on Global Market Trends and Heating Systems

Q1: How do crude oil prices impact my monthly heating bill?

Crude oil price changes affect the cost of heating oil and propane directly. Higher oil prices mean higher fuel costs, increasing monthly bills for systems dependent on these fuels.

Q2: Should I switch to a heat pump during volatile oil markets?

Heat pumps generally offer more stable operating costs since they use electricity, which may be less affected by crude oil price swings, especially in regions with renewable energy.

Q3: Can I reduce heating costs without replacing my system?

Yes. Improving insulation, using smart thermostats, and regular maintenance can reduce energy consumption and cost regardless of fuel price fluctuations.

Q4: How do global supply chain issues affect heating system installation?

Delays and price surges in raw materials or components can increase installation costs and lead times, underlining the importance of early planning.

Q5: What financing options are best during economic uncertainty?

Fixed-rate loans or government incentive programs for energy-efficient equipment upgrades are advisable to secure predictable payments and lower upfront costs.
